How to install Ubuntu on Windows XP using a virtual box
Instuctions - By Jon Nelson
Software downloads needed
- Download Virtual box from Web page.
- Create a folder labeled Virtual Box on your PC
 - Logon to the internet Type http://www.virtualbox.org/
 - For Windows XP select Virtual box Older builds
 - Select option Virtual Box 3.2
 - Select first option for windows host
 - Now save the file to the fold you created labeled Virtual box on your PC
 - Once the download is complete then you can run the download.
